(20 Feb 1925, The Carter Express, Carter, Beckham Co, OK): Miss Clara Folks, daughter of Mr. and Mrs. J. W. Folks of Carter, died at their home here early Tuesday morning. Clara was born on Jan. 31st, 1908 and died Feb. 17th, 1925, being a little past 17 years old. She was a sweet, lovable little girl, one who had always been as a delicate flower, having been afflicted since birth with a weak heart, but despite this fact she had always been a good student and never missed her class at school or Sunday school when it was so she could go. She took a great interest in her work and was a Junior in the Carter school at the time of her death. The funeral services were held at the Methodist church on Tuesday afternoon by Rev. Carson, pastor of the church. The church was filled to overflowing, there being about as many on the outside of the building as on the inside. The floral offerings were many and very beautiful. School was dismissed and the teachers and pupils attended the funeral services in a body. The pall bearers were six boys chosen from the Epworth League of which Clara was a member. Clara will be sadly missed by the people of Carter, by her teachers and the pupils of the school, and the Sunday school which she attended, for she and her sweet, quiet way was loved by all who knew her; but she will be missed most by her mother and father, who have watched over her so tenderly, by her brother Cecil and her little sister Geraldine. To these her nearest relatives, we, with the people of Carter and vicinity extend our deepest sympathy in their time of sorrow. Interment was made in the Carter cemetery, a large crowd following the remains to their last resting place. (24 Feb 1925, Elk City News Democrat, Elk City, Beckham Co, OK): DEATH OF CLARA FOLKS. Miss Clara Folks, of Carter died February 17th of flu. She was the daughter of Mr. and Mrs. J. W. Folks and was seventeen years of age. Mr. Folks is connected with the Co-Operative at Carter. Miss Clara was well-known young lady and had a sweet christian character, being a prominent worker in the Methodist church and Epworth League and was teacher in the Sunday School. School closed for the funeral services and the young men who acted as pall bearers were from Epworth League.
